  • Trial Court Clerk II - 4th Judicial District

    Kansas Judicial Branch (Garnett, KS)



    Apply Now

    Position number:                   K0047145

     

    Location of Employment:       4th Judicial District, Anderson County, Kansas 66032

     

    Classification and Grade:         Trial Court Clerk II, Grade 18, $18.57 an hour, $19.04 at six months of satisfactory performance, $20.47 at one year of satisfactory performance

     

    Kansas Judicial Branch Benefits State Employment Center - Benefits (ks.gov) (https://admin.ks.gov/services/state-employment-center/benefits)

     

    Internal candidates will be considered first.

     

    Job Duties: This is a full-time position in the Clerk of the District Court office in Anderson County.  This is a clerical position responsible for receipting and filing documents, to include electronic filing, scanning/imaging documents, data entry, receipting monies, setting hearings, maintaining court calendars, and performing other related work as required.  Will cross train in multiple areas of the district court.  This position requires excellent customer service skills as it provides information and assistance to judiciary, attorneys, law enforcement agencies, state agencies and the public.

     

    Required education and experience:   Graduation from high school and six months’ clerical experience.  Knowledge of modern office procedures and practices.  Skills with computers and operation of standard office equipment.

     

    Preferred qualifications: Experience working in a computerized office, knowledge of computers and financial transactions. Excellent customer service skills. Knowledge of court procedures and policies desirable.

     

    APPLICATION PROCEDURE: Submit a current resume which states your qualifications, education, and experience as it relates to this position.  https://www.kscourts.org/Public/Court-Careers

     

    Application deadline: Open until filled

     

    The successful candidate will be required to undergo a criminal background check, complete a drug test, and apply for a Tax Clearance Certificate within 10 days from the date of the offer letter .
